Why Choose a Trusted Window Installer?
Choosing the right window installation contractor is vital for several reasons:
Quality of Work: A trusted installer has the experience and abilities required to ensure that windows are installed properly, which directly impacts their efficiency and durability.
Safety Concerns: Improper installation can lead to security issues, making it important to engage experts who stick to market requirements.
Energy Efficiency: The correct installation of windows can considerably impact a home's energy usage. Inadequately set up windows can cause air leaks, which can increase energy expenses.
Guarantees and Guarantees: Trusted installers often supply warranties for both their work and the windows themselves, offering comfort for house owners.
Compliance with Building Codes: A professional installer understands and follows local building regulations, guaranteeing that your installation is legal and safe.

How do I understand if I need new windows?
Indications that you might require brand-new windows consist of drafts, condensation in between panes, difficulty opening or closing windows, and visible modifications in your energy expenses.
2. What kinds of windows should I pick?
Selecting window types depends on personal choice, energy efficiency goals, and the architectural design of your home. Typical types consist of double-hung, sliding, casement, and bay windows.
3. For how long does window installation take?
The installation time can vary based upon numerous factors, consisting of the number of windows being changed and any required repair work. Typically, it can take anywhere from a few hours to a couple of days.
4. What can I do to get ready for window installation?
To prepare for window installation, clear the area around the windows of furnishings and decors, and make sure the installers have easy access to the needed workspaces.
